Kev, the brakes were ok when I was paxing you around but it started to judder really badly when I was taking Tony. I guess as the track was drying up and I had done more laps. Not very confidence inspiring. It was the first time I tried the RS14 on the track and though it bites much harder than the RS42, I found they give out a lot more brake dust
When I inspected the disks, the holes were completely filled with the dust, rather like the stock Brembo pads
The higher temperature may be the cause of this??? I hope this will be cured but I doubt it. Anyone has a solution? I don't really want to go back to RS42 as the front pads were crumbling away when Ali took them out, suggesting the pads were over heating.
